Patient Care, the Medical School at the University of Minnesota

 

The Medical School has a network of clinical affiliations in the Twin Cities and the state of Minnesota that provide quality care for Minnesota families and a comprehensive educational experience for our students and residents.

University of Minnesota Medical Center and University of Minnesota Children's Hospital, both divisions of Fairview, are the core teaching facilities on campus--where more than 400 full-time faculty provide clinical services. Many also teach and practice at affiliated hospitals in the community.

University of Minnesota Physicians is the Medical School’s faculty practice plan, an integrated multi-specialty group practice and a separate non-profit corporation.
